Owwwww that noise hurts my teeth articles, project cars, conversations, and more

Owwwww that noise hurts my teeth Forum Topics

How do I find the quietest 17”tires for my second wheelset for my dual-duty car?
Learn Me Files
More Owwwww that noise hurts my teeth Topics

Back to all tags

Our Preferred Partners